Neural network image processing matlab book

Neural network training with nntool box using image processing with matlab. This interdisciplinary survey brings together recent models and experiments on how the brain sees and learns to recognize objects. What is the best book to learn to make a neural network. There is one popular machine learning territory we have not set feet on yet the image recognition. What is the best free book to learn a neural network using matlab. Basically this book explains terminology, methods of neural network with examples in matlab. Thank you for downloading image compression neural network matlab code thesis.

How to train neural network to compare two images learn more about digital image processing, image processing, image, image analysis, image segmentation, image acquisition, neural networks, neural network image processing toolbox, deep learning toolbox. Segmentation of remote sensing images using similaritymeasurebased fusion mrf model. Several chapters describe experiments in neurobiology and visual perception that clarify properties of biological. Ieee matlab projects on image processing and signal processing in bangalore for final year btech mtech ececse students. I dont know how to train and test neural network with image processing. You may design a neural network to tell your whether or not there is a tumor in the image, but it is not a trivial task for a neural network to tell you where it is located. Image compression neural network matlab code thesis. Recurrent neural networks rnn have a long history and were already developed during the 1980s. Neural network toolbox for matlab free computer books. Matlab projects bangalore 2019 matlab projects on image.

These is a user guide available for the same neural network toolbox for use with matlab. Hello all, i have 4 documents regarding neural network i want to implement one in matlab, to use it as a part of another project. It shows how to use these insights in technology and describes how neural networks provide a unifying computational framework for reaching these goals. Examples and pretrained networks make it easy to use matlab for deep learning, even without knowledge of advanced computer vision algorithms or neural networks. What are the matlab toolboxes needed to run deep learning on.

Deep learning toolbox provides a framework for designing and implementing deep neural networks with algorithms, pretrained models, and apps. Hopfield, can be considered as one of the first network with recurrent connections 10. The book expands and adds on to some third edition topics, including deep learning and deep neural networks. On the other hand, matlab can simulate how neural networks work easily with few lines of code. Mias database has been used for testing the performance of the algorithm. Neural network training with nntool box using image. This demo uses alexnet, a pretrained deep convolutional neural network that has been trained on over a million images.

The repository implements the a simple convolutional neural network cnn from scratch for image. This article has to a large extent been an overview of what can now perhaps be called the neural network hype in image processing. For a complete example of an image classification problem using a small dataset of flower images, with and without image data augmentation, check my matlab file exchange contribution 8. This book will teach you many of the core concepts behind neural networks and deep learning. Getting started with neural network toolbox using matlab.

Is there an efficient book that i can learn artificial. Matlab neural network and fuzzy toolbox are the best for deep learning techniques. If you are already familiar with the concept, then you can directly go to section four and see how to train a deep neural network using matlab. Ship out in 2 business day, and fast shipping, free tracking number will be provided after the shipment. A list of 15 new image processing books you should read in 2020, such as mysql for java. Matlab implementation of neural networks results for alarmwarning control system of mobile robot with five ultrasonic sensors. This chapter aims to explore gpuenabled matlab functions on several toolboxes other than parallel computing toolbox, like communications system toolbox, image processing toolbox, neural network toolbox, phased array system toolbox, signal processing toolbox, and statistics and machine learning toolbox.

Discover how to build, train, and serve your own deep neural networks with. Artificial neural networks applied for digital images with matlab code. Localization of license plate number using dynamic image processing techniques and. Neural network training with nntool box using image processing.

The super matlab neural network learning handbook cd with the book, the super matlab neural network learning manual neural network structure as the main line, to learning for byline, combines a variety of examples, to enable the reader easily to understand and apply. Learn machine learning february 11, 2018 february 12, 2018. For image classification and image regression, you can train using multiple gpus or in parallel. Darknet yolo this is yolov3 and v2 for windows and linux. An entire chapter is devoted to deep learning, neural networks, and.

Similar work was done in the digital image processing course at iit bombay. Rather than reading a good book with a cup of tea in the afternoon, instead they. Neural network toolbox an overview sciencedirect topics. This book is designed for the first course on neural networks. The toolbox includes convolutional neural network and autoencoder deep learning algorithms for image classification and feature learning tasks. Which is a suitable book for matlab programming for image. The most advanced approaches are based on specialised compression modules. Matlab neural network toolbox workflow by dr ravichandran.

Proficient in matlab neural network with cd matlab fine books. You can build network architectures such as generative adversarial networks gans and siamese networks using automatic differentiation, custom training loops, and shared weights. Proficient in matlab neural network with cd matlab fine. Neural network projects using matlab neural network projects using matlab is one of the preeminent domains, which has attracted many students and research scholars due to its evergreen research scope.

And you will be able to train a deep neural network using matlab. The book presents readers with the application of neural networks to areas like bioinformatics, robotics, communication, image processing, and healthcare. Demonstrates how neural networks can be used to aid in the solution of digital signal processing dsp or imaging problems. Artificial neural networks applied for digital images with matlab. Convolutional neural network cnn image classification in matlab duration. Convolutional neural network for image classification. The hopfield network, which was introduced in 1982 by j. Typical workflow for training a network using an augmented image datastore from 7. The book integrates material from the 4th edition of digital image processing by gonzalez. Neural networks for vision and image processing the mit. Neural networks for vision and image processing a bradford book. To learn properly, following the sequence given below is recommended. Neural network matlab is a powerful technique which is used to solve many real world problems. Digit al signal processing dep artment of ma thema tical modelling technical universit y of denmark intr oduction t o arti cial neur al networks jan lar sen 1st edition c no v ember 1999 b y jan lar sen.

Deep learning toolbox documentation mathworks australia. Looking for simple and straight to the point sources for image processing and neural networks. Matlab programming for image conversion step by step why 2d to 3d image conversion is needed. The book presents the theory of neural networks, discusses their design. In this article, i will explain the concept of convolution neural networks cnns using many swan pictures and will make the case of using cnns over regular multilayer perceptron neural networks for processing images. In many industrial, medical, and scientific imageprocessing applications, feature and patternrecognition techniques such as normalized correlation are used to match specific features in an image with known templates. Solution manual for the text book neural network design 2nd edition by martin t. Simple introduction to convolutional neural networks. Deep learning uses neural networks to learn useful representations of features directly from data. Neural networks are based on the human brain and nervous system, which calculates approximate functions according to the number of inputs provided. Fundamentals of digital signal processing using matlab edition electrical engineering books. Matlab has a neural network toolbox that also comes with a gui. Image processing and neural networks classify complex. But now the wait is over, in this post we are going to teach our machine to recognize images by using convolutional.

How can i customize my convolution neural network cnn to deal with gray images 2d. Let us assume that we want to create a neural network model that is capable of recognizing swans in images. Neural networks and deep learning currently provide the best solutions to many problems in image recognition, speech recognition, and natural language processing. Python image recognizer with convolutional neural network.

You can use convolutional neural networks convnets, cnns and long shortterm memory lstm networks to perform classification and regression on image, timeseries, and text data. Is it better to build a new neural network or use an existing pretrained network for image classification. Maybe you have knowledge that, people have search numerous times for their chosen novels like this image compression neural network matlab code thesis, but end up in harmful downloads. Image processing and neural networks classify complex defects. Deep learning in 11 lines of matlab code see how to use matlab, a simple webcam, and a deep neural network to identify objects in your surroundings. Thus you should already be familiar with the topic including the construction of neural networks via matlab or whatever toolkit with which you feel comfortable, and. Data augmentation for image classification applications. Developing neural network in matlab method2 nntool fitting tool duration. This short ebook is your guide to the basic techniques. Convolutional neural networks cnns using a pretrained network like alexnet for image recognition and image. For more details about the approach taken in the book, see here. Digital image processing using matlab, 3rd edition matlab. Breast cancer detection using neural networks image.

Prmlprmlt matlab code for machine learning algorithms in book prml. Change mathematics operators to matlab operators and toolbox functions. Neural network toolbox provides simple matlab commands for creating and interconnecting the layers of a deep neural network. The distribution of temperature can be described using graycontour based on digital image processing with matlab, at the same time in course of image enhancement processing, by the means of. The work studies the use of artificial neural network in the field of image processing. Use trainnetwork to train a convolutional neural network convnet, cnn, a long shortterm memory lstm network, or a bidirectional lstm bilstm network for deep learning classification and regression problems. This article is a foundation for the following practical articles, where we will explain how to. Hello, you can avail the necessary books for free at mypustak.

It is indias first online platform which works towards making education available to all, across the geographical and social boundaries. Does any one can suggest a good book or website for this. This chapter presents the gpuenabled functions on these toolboxes with a variety of real. Always stressing the practical and the intuitive, this book disk set will enable you to perform all relevant techniques and procedures. A large section is devoted to the design and training of complexdomain multiplelayer feedforward networks mlfnsall essential equations are presented and justified. The general neural networks are used for image recognition, not for pin pointing details in an image. For example, you can use a pretrained neural network to. Youll see that deep learning is within your graspyou dont need to be an expert to get. Download pdf matlab deep learning free usakochan pdf.

Neural network matlab is used to perform specific applications as pattern recognition or data classification. Information processing paradigm in neural network matlab projects is inspired by biological nervous systems. This project explains breast cancer detection using neural networks. So please help me in finding good books on matlab on image processing facial.

1229 837 1337 1528 1239 802 1254 1309 66 422 109 1557 1539 673 1364 381 452 1118 339 1227 156 1515 1193 759 1247 1091 1243 1431 575 459 848 204 581 359 649 61